Understanding Crankcase Pressure Sensors
Definition and Importance
A crankcase pressure sensor is an electronic device that measures the pressure within an engine¡¯s crankcase. This measurement is crucial for several engine management functions, including diagnostics, performance optimization, and emissions control. The sensor plays a pivotal role in maintaining engine health and efficiency by detecting irregularities and allowing for timely intervention.
Functions of Crankcase Pressure Sensors
- Real-Time Monitoring: Continuous data on crankcase pressure is provided by the sensor, enabling immediate adjustments to engine parameters.
- Diagnostic Capabilities: The sensor helps in identifying potential issues such as excessive blow-by, which could indicate engine component wear or damage.
- Emissions Control: By monitoring pressure levels, the sensor aids in ensuring emissions stay within regulatory limits, contributing to overall environmental compliance.
Applications of Crankcase Pressure Sensors
Crankcase pressure sensors find applications in various sectors, including:
- Automotive Industry: Monitoring engine performance, optimizing fuel efficiency, and ensuring compliance with stringent emissions regulations.
- Industrial Machinery: Preventing machinery failures and maintaining operational efficiency in heavy equipment.
- Marine Applications: Ensuring reliability and safety of marine engines.

Typical Price Ranges for Crankcase Pressure Sensors
Entry-Level Sensors
Entry-level crankcase pressure sensors typically range from $20 to $50 per unit. These sensors are ideal for basic applications and may have limited features and specifications.
Characteristics of Entry-Level Sensors
- Basic Functionality: These sensors usually provide essential pressure monitoring without advanced diagnostic features.
- Lower Accuracy: Entry-level sensors may have lower accuracy compared to mid-range and high-end models, making them suitable for less demanding applications.
Mid-Range Sensors
Mid-range crankcase pressure sensors generally fall within the price range of $50 to $150 per unit. These sensors offer a balance between performance and cost, making them suitable for a wide range of applications.
Characteristics of Mid-Range Sensors
- Enhanced Features: Mid-range sensors often come with improved accuracy and additional features, such as diagnostic capabilities.
- Versatility: These sensors are suitable for various applications, including automotive and industrial machinery.
High-End Sensors
High-end crankcase pressure sensors can range from $150 to $500 or more per unit. These sensors are designed for demanding applications and offer advanced features and high precision.
Characteristics of High-End Sensors
- Advanced Technology: High-end sensors utilize advanced materials and technology to provide superior performance and reliability.
- High Accuracy: These sensors typically offer higher accuracy and better reliability, making them suitable for critical applications.
